Picking the Best Oil Rubbed Bronze Kitchen Faucets on the Net

Oil rubbed bronze kitchen faucets have become one of the most desired kitchen plumbing fixtures for the up-to-date kitchen. Ten years ago, kitchen faucets were viewed as a obligatory eyesore and were hidden in dim niches. There are so many another different intentions for the kitchen faucet, that it has become fun, instead of a job when planning this home project. Today, they have become rather up-to-date and are often the focus of attention for a up-to-date kitchen. Recent improvements to the kitchen faucet have changed this concealed utility into an prominent display composition. Various makes of spigots own a functional brush or spray feature that makes washing the dinner pans, a little less tedious.

The first matter you will need to do is figure out the theme for your kitchen. This is where the absolute majority of people go wrong in their choice. Oil rubbed bronze kitchen faucets may look remarkable in on the showroom floor with black granite counters and a up-to-date design. But take that same faucet and ram it into a 1880 colonial kitchen and you abruptly experience an eyesore. Unless you’re remodeling the entire kitchen, observe the first style.

There is a large selection of kitchen spigots accessible to today’s consumer and selecting the perfect one for your kitchen may appear like a challenging job. And since trustworthy kitchen faucet reviews are few and far between, observe these rules of thumb and you will have little trouble in selecting the perfect focal piece to your kitchen sink.

The following step is to decide on a finish. Some of the most modern finishes are stainless steel, chrome, nickel, copper, antique as well as oil rubbed bronze kitchen faucets are accessible. Chrome is the most cost-effective finish while copper tends to be the most extravagant. Chrome and stainless steel provide superior scratch resistance while the bronze and copper finishes are often the most decorative. Colored enamel was frequently utilized to produce kitchen faucets, but since they were easily discolored, chipped and scratched buyers have went away from this choice.

The following step is to decide on the type of handle you will choose. The popular handgrips are single handed, dual handed and the standard “cross-shaped” design. If your sink is rather wide, you may choose a 2 handle design. Modern-day kitchen faucets are often a cross designed. The cross design is very useable and often give a kitchen a unusual look when coordinated with an exotic or stylish handle.

The final matter you need to be interested with is the “nuts and bolts” of your kitchen faucet. Make certain you acknowledge the difference in a cartridge, ceramic disk, ball valve and compression valve, and single hole kitchen faucets. Make certain you are getting the water flow and operation you wish. What goes in one home may not go in yours. Style may be the number one element when finding your next kitchen faucet, but substance should never be disregarded.

These are merely a few tips to keep in mind when picking out your next kitchen’s center piece. Whether you’re searching through oil rubbed bronze kitchen faucets for a fresh conception, searching for an affordable chrome replacement, observe these tips and your succeeding faucet will be your best kitchen faucet.
